Альтернативный код на случай отсутствия рекламных предложений у рекламодателей

15 Сен 2011 в 21:19

Многие партнёрские сайты в нашей сети имеют самый различный трафик по географической принадлежности, но вот рекламодатели в основной своей массе готовы принимать только трафик из Москвы, Московской области или других крупных городов нашей необъятной родины, что уж говорить о зарубежном трафике, который тоже присутствует на сайтах наших партнёров. Т.е. на данный момент, посетители, пришедшие на сайт партнёра из регионов, на которые не распространяется таргетинг наших рекламодателей, попросту не увидят никакой рекламы, что не совсем хорошо. Эта проблема довольно легко решается при помощи простого кода, который давным давно размещён в нашем FAQ, но так как его никто не читает, мало кто этим пользуется. В сегодняшнем посте я подробно расскажу о том, как использовать альтернативный код.

Сначала разберём моменты, когда нужно использовать вывод альтернативной рекламы:

  1. Если на сайте партнёра не только трафик с Московского региона, но и со всей страны и даже мира
  2. Если сайт партнёра с карточками товаров или обзорами, где используются блоки «Где Купить»

Ситуация первая, когда партнёр разместил рекламный материал на сайте, будь это рекламная зона с баннерами из Микс-Юни или блок контекстного товара из Микс-Товаров, не важно. На его сайт заходят посетители из регионов, но нашим рекламодателям такой трафик не нужен, поэтому на месте рекламного объявления будет пустота и теоретически партнёр теряет на этом деньги, поэтому очень важно, при отсутствии рекламных материалов у наших партнёров выдавать им альтернативную рекламу.

В роли альтернативной рекламы может выступать как контекстная реклама, так и реклама других партнёрских программ. Более того, не обязательно вообще взамен выводить другую рекламу, можно выводить всё что угодно: ссылки на полезные статьи, последние сообщения с форума, комментарии с блогов, баннеры призывающие к каким-то внутренним страницам на сайте и тд.

Допустим, мы хотим в случае отсутствия рекламных предложений для созданной рекламной зоны выводить альтернативный код, для этого нужно скопировать код для вывода зоны и дополнить его ещё одним div, который будет отображаться в случае отсутствия рекламных предложений. В итоге код будет выглядеть следующим образом:

<!-- разместите на месте показа блока -->
<div id="mix_block_XXXXXXXXXX"></div>
<noindex><textarea id="mix_block_XXXXXXXXXX_alternate" style="display: none;">
 
Здесь разместите альтернативный код
 
</textarea></noindex> 
 
<!-- разместите в самом конце страницы, перед тегом </body> -->
<script type="text/javascript">
document.write('<scr ' + 'ipt language="javascript" type="text/javascript" src="http://XXXXXXXXXX.us.mixmarket.biz/uni/us/XXXXXXXXXX/?div=mix_block_XXXXXXXXXX&r=' + escape(document.referrer) + '&rnd=' + Math.round(Math.random() * 100000) + '" charset="windows-1251">< ' + '/scr' + 'ipt>');
</scr></script>

От стандартного он будет отличаться лишь вот этим кусочком:

<noindex><textarea id="mix_block_XXXXXXXXXX_alternate" style="display: none;">
 
Здесь разместите альтернативный код
 
</textarea></noindex>

В этом кусочке стоит обратить внимание только на id, который должен отличаться от id основного блока окончанием _alternate. На месте «Здесь разместите альтернативный код» нужно вставить код вызова любой другой рекламы или чего либо другого.

Ситуация вторая, когда партнёр на сайте размещает на карточках товара или в обзорах блоки «Где Купить», но далеко не всегда у наших рекламодателей есть предложения по конкретным товарам по ряду причин. Например, на сайте партнёра публикуется обзор товара, который ещё не поступил в продажу на Российском рынке или наоборот уже вышел из оборота, в таких случаях место будет пустовать. С помощью простого кода на пустующем месте можно выводить, например, рекламные блоки Яндекс.Маркета у которого количество товарных предложений гораздо выше или обычную контекстную рекламу.

Вызов альтернативного кода в этом случае абсолютно идентичен тому, что мы использовали в предыдущем примере, нужно только взять код вызова блока «Где Купить» и дополнить его кодом как в первом примере:

<!-- разместите на месте показа блока -->
<div id="mixgk_XXXXXXXXXX"></div>
<noindex><textarea id="mixgk_XXXXXXXXXX_alternate" style="display: none;">
 
Здесь разместите альтернативный код
 
</textarea></noindex> 
 
<!-- разместите в самом конце страницы, перед тегом </body> -->
<script>
document.write('<scr ' + 'ipt language="javascript" type="text/javascript" src="http://XXXXXXXXXX.gk.mixmarket.biz/XXXXXXXXXX/?type=vert&pagesize=5&brand=&model=&cat_id=&div=mixgk_XXXXXXXXXX&r=' + escape(document.referrer) + '&rnd=' + Math.round(Math.random() * 100000) + '" charset="windows-1251">< ' + '/scr' + 'ipt>');
</scr></script>

Как  видите всё довольно просто, а самое главное при той же посещаемости может существенно увеличить доход от конкретной площадки. Пользуйтесь на здоровье, если что-то не понятно спрашивайте, с удовольствием ответим на все Ваши вопросы.

Александр Кузнецов
Специалист по работе с ключевыми партнерами Партнерской сети Миксмаркет
Комментарии: 2
  1. Николай:

    Т.е. механизм, который понимает, что в основном блоке ничего нет и убирает display:none из альтернативного блока находится где-то на вашей стороне?

Оставить комментарий